Tech Data to Appeal French Competition Authority’s Antitrust Decision
March 24, 2020 6:00 AM EDTBARCELONA, Spain--(BUSINESS WIRE)-- Tech Data (Nasdaq: TECD) today announced it disagrees with and will be appealing the findings and legal reasoning of the French Competition Authority (FCA) in its decision against Tech Data.
